T9 Mode Basics

The Shift key turns letter cases: “T9” (normal), “T9” (initial cap.) and “T9” (caps. lock).

The Next key displays the next choice.

The Space key selects a word and adds a space.

Abc Mode

The Abc mode allows you to enter characters by repeatedly press- ing the digit key. For example, to enter “J” press 5 JKL once, and to enter “L” press 5 JKL three times.

Abc Mode Basics

The Shift key turns letter cases: “abc” (normal), “Abc” (initial cap.) and “ABC” (caps. lock).

The Space key adds a space.
